Свойства набора данных мозаики
Есть три группы свойств наборов данных мозаики: общие, по умолчанию и ключевые метаданные. Общие свойства аналогичны тем, которые вы найдете для всех растровых данных, например, источник данных, экстент, размеры ячеек и битовая глубины. Свойства по умолчанию для набора данных мозаики есть также определенные свойства, которые включают информацию, характерную для наборов нерастровых данных. Эти свойства влияют на то, как мозаичное изображение будет присутствовать для пользователя (или клиента) и как они могут взаимодействовать с ним. Свойства ключевых метаданных получаются на основе определения продукта, если он определен для набора данных мозаики. Он содержит информацию о каналах и длине волны, используемую для вывода и обработки. Определение продукта можно изменить на закладке Общие (General). Более подробно об общих свойствах или ключевых метаданных см. Свойства наборов растровых данных.
Любые свойства, задаваемые для слоя мозаики в таблице содержания, будут применяться только к слою и не хранятся в наборе данных мозаики, например комбинация каналов или метод мозаики. Таким образом, если у набора данных мозаики несколько пользователей, это не повлияет на настройку слоя другого пользователя. Это такое же поведение, что и у любого набора данных и слоя.
Вы можете открыть диалоговое окно Свойства набора данных мозаики (Mosaic Dataset Properties) через окно Каталог (Catalog) или в ArcCatalog, щелкнув правой кнопкой на наборе данных мозаики и выбрав Свойства (Properties). Здесь можно изменять свойства. Вы можете редактировать значения в диалоговом окне, щелкнув значение напротив свойства. Вы сможете ввести другое значение или выбрать из списка. Кроме того, можно изменять свойства с помощью инструмента Установить свойства набора данных мозаики.
Свойства на закладке По умолчанию (Default) могут также влиять на производительность сервера или сервиса изображений при публикации данных мозаики. При публикации набора данных мозаики с помощью ArcGIS for Server, администратор сервера может изменить некоторые из этих свойств в составе параметров сервиса изображений; однако они не могут превышать заданные вами максимальные значения. Например, если допустить создание мозаики только тремя методами, администратор не сможет добавить четвертый метод. Или, если вы установите максимальное число выгружаемых элементов, они могут уменьшить это число, но не увеличить. Если вы изменили свойства так, чтобы они превышали заданные значения, или ограничили их, например, изменили параметр Максимальный размер запросов, необходимо повторно полностью опубликовать набор данных мозаики. Если вы повторно запустите сервис изображений, измененные свойства набора данных мозаики не будут отобраны.
Свойства изображений
- Максимальный размер запросов – свойство применяется только при публикации набора данных мозаики в виде сервиса изображений и при доступе к нему. Максимальное количество строк и столбцов при каждой генерации мозаичного изображения. Увеличивая эти числа, вы будете увеличивать время, которое занимает обработка мозаичного изображения. Однако вы можете увеличить эти числа, если вы распечатываете очень большие изображения большого разрешения. Если эти числа будут слишком малы, мозаичное изображение может не отображаться. Например, если изменить эти числа на 10, окно отображения изображения будет иметь размер всего 10 пикселов, что меньше, чем необходимо для изображения.
- Допустимые методы сжатия: определяет метод сжатия, используемый для передачи мозаичных изображений с сервера клиенту. Это свойство влияет на сервис изображений, созданный из набора данных мозаики. Если доступ к сервису изображений осуществляется через LAN, большие объемы данных не вызовут проблемы. Однако, при работе через медленные подключения в Интернете, будет лучше применить сжатие к снимку до передачи. Это сжатие уменьшает размер переносимого снимка, но устанавливает дополнительную нагрузку на сервер для первоначального сжатия данных. Это может изменить клиент.
- None – К изображению не применяется сжатие, что обеспечивает высокое качество, но в результате по сети передаются данные в максимальном объеме.
- LZ77 – Эффективный метод сжатия без потерь, который рекомендуется применять для изображений со сходными значениями пикселов (с дискретными данными), например, для сканированных карт или результатов классификации.
- JPEG – Эффективный метод сжатия, который часто может сжимать снимок примерно в три-восемь раз с небольшим ухудшением качества изображения. При выборе метода JPEG качество изображения регулируется значениями от 0 до 100. При значении 80, качество изображения остается достаточно хорошим, тогда как размер сжимается примерно в 8 раз.
- LERC – эффективный метод сжатия с потерями, который рекомендуется применять для данных с большой глубиной пиксела, в частности, для данных с плавающей точкой, 32-, 16- и 12-разрядных данных. При выборе этого метода необходимо указать параметр качества, который представляет собой максимальную ошибку для одного пиксела (а не среднюю ошибку для всего изображения). Это значение измеряется в единицах набора данных мозаики. Например, если ошибка равна 10 см, а единицы измерения набора данных мозаики – метры, введите 0.1.
Метод LERC более эффективен (в 5–10 раз) и занимает меньше времени (в 5–10 раз) при сжатии изображений типа float, чем метод LZ77, и для изображений с целочисленными значениями он также лучше подходит. При использовании целочисленных данных, если установлен предел ошибки 0,99 или менее, считается, что метод LERC работает без потерь.
Метод перевыборки по умолчанию (Default Resampling Method) – Определяет метод перевыборки пикселов по умолчанию, которые подбираются так, чтобы соответствовать разрешению отображения пользователя (или клиентского запроса при опубликовании). Использование или ввод данных влияет на выбранный метод. Это также свойство, задаваемое в слое набора данных мозаики (или в слое сервиса изображений), и пользователь может изменить настройку в своем слое, при этом настройка по умолчанию в наборе данных мозаики не изменится.
Более точные радиометрические значения получаются при использовании выборки пиксела по методу ближайшего соседа. В целом, это быстрее, но может привести к неровным ребрам пространственных объектов. Билинейная интерполяция обеспечивает более гладкие изображения, но может привести к некоторому сглаживанию изображения. Билинейная интерполяция рекомендуется для непрерывных растровых данных. Кубическая свертка геометрически более точная, но немного медленнее, чем билинейная интерполяция. Метод большинства лучше применять к дискретным данным.
- Максимальное число растров в мозаике (Maximum Number Of Rasters Per Mosaic) – предотвращает создание мозаики на сервере из неразумно большого количества растров, если, например, клиент увеличивает масштаб просмотра в наборе данных неоптимизированного сервиса изображений, в котором не созданы обзоры. Значение по умолчанию равно 20.
- Коэффициент допуска размера ячейки Factor (Cell Size Tolerance Factor): используется для управления группировкой элементов набора данных мозаики для выполнения некоторых операций, например создания мозаики или создания швов. Коэффициент 0,1 значит, что все значения LowPS на 10 процентов больше наименьшего размера в пикселах считаются одинаковыми. Это значение должно быть больше или равно 0,0. Результаты можно увидеть в таблице Уровни (щелкните правой кнопкой набор данных мозаики в таблице содержания и выберите Открыть > Таблица уровней).
- Допустимые методы мозаики (Allowed Mosaic Methods): определяет порядок растров, которые совмещаются в мозаику для создания изображения. Вы можете выбрать один или несколько методов мозаики, из которых один будет использоваться по умолчанию. Пользователь может выбирать из выбранных вами методов.
- Ближайшие к центру (Closest to Center) - Позволяет сортировать растры на основе порядка по умолчанию, где растры, центры которых ближе всего к центру просмотра, размещаются наверху.
- Ближайшие к надиру (Closest to Nadir) - Позволяет сортировать растры по расстоянию между положением надира и центру обзора. Этот метод сходен с методом Ближайшие к центру (Closest to Center), но использует точку надира к растру, которое может отличаться от центра, особенно для изображения косой.
- Ближайшие к точке просмотра (Closest to Viewpoint) - Размещает растры в порядке на основе определенного пользователем местоположения и местоположения надира для растров с помощью инструмента Точка обзора (Viewpoint).
- По атрибуту (By Attribute) - Включает порядок растров на основе определенного атрибута метаданных и его отличия от базового значения.
- Северо-Запад (North-West) - Включает порядок растров независимым от обзора способом, где растры с центрами на северо-западе отображаются сверху.
- Линия сшивки (Seamline) - Обрезает растр, используя заранее определённую форму разрыва для каждого растра с помощью дополнительного расположения вдоль разрывов и располагает изображения на основании поля SOrder в таблице атрибутов.
- Блокировка растра (Lock Raster) - Позволяет блокировать отображение одного или нескольких растра на основе ObjectID.
- Нет (None) - Располагает растры на основании порядкового значения (ObjectID) в таблице атрибутов набора данных мозаики.
Примечание:Результат метода мозаики может зависеть от параметра ZOrder, который используется при определении того, как растры соединяются при использовании методов мозаики Ближайший к центру (Closest To Center), Северо- Запад (North-West), По атрибуту (By Attribute), Ближайший к Надиру (Closest To Nadir) и Ближайший к точке обзора (Closest To Viewpoint). При использовании этих методов мозаики растры всегда сначала сортируются в Z-порядке.
- Порядок сортировки по умолчанию (Default Sorting Order): управляет ожидаемым упорядочением изображений, определенных методом мозаики. При сортировке изображений по возрастанию, их порядок будет соответствовать методу мозаики. По убыванию (Descending) будет обратный порядок. Например, если метод мозаики – Ближайший к центру (Closest To Center) и выбран порядок По убыванию (Descending), то будет показано самое далекое от центра изображение.
- Оператор мозаики по умолчанию (Default Mosaic Operator): позволяет определять, как будет выполняться разрешение перекрывающихся ячеек, например при выборе операции смешивания.
- Первый (First) – Перекрывающиеся области будут содержать ячейки из первого набора растровых данных, перечисленного в источнике.
- Последний (Last) – Перекрывающиеся области будут содержать ячейки из последнего набора растровых данных, перечисленного в источнике.
- Минимальный (Min) – Перекрывающиеся области будут содержать минимальные значения ячеек из всех перекрывающихся областей.
- Максимальный (Max) – Перекрывающиеся области будут содержать максимальные значения ячеек из всех перекрывающихся областей.
- Среднее (Mean) – Перекрывающиеся области будут содержать средние значения ячеек из всех перекрывающихся областей.
- Смесь – перекрывающимися областями будет смесь значений ячеек, которые перекрываются по краю каждого набора растровых данных в мозаичном изображении. По умолчанию край определяется контуром или линией сшивки для каждого растра.
Ширина смешивания (Blend Width): определяет расстояние в пикселах (в масштабе отображения), используемое оператором мозаики Смешивание (Blend).
Это значение будет разделено напополам по краю. Таким образом, если значение равно 40, то смешиваться будут 20 пикселов на внутренней стороне контура и 20 пикселов на внешней.
Если присутствуют швы, то ширину и тип смешивания необходимо задавать для каждого шва в таблице швов, что переопределяет данное значение.
- Параметры точки просмотра: если используется метод мозаики Ближайший к точке просмотра, будут применяться эти параметры:
- Пространство x, y точки просмотра – определяет сдвиг, который используется для расчета того, где находится центр области интереса (вида отображения), если вы нажмёте кнопку со стрелкой в диалоговом окне Точка просмотра. Эти значения вычисляются в единицах системы пространственной привязки набора данных мозаики.
- Всегда вырезать растр по контуру – можно использовать для ограничения экстента каждого растра его контуром.
- Контуры могут содержать NoData – можно выбрать, будут ли значения NoData верными значениями пикселов. Если Да то, когда метод построения мозаики использует растры со значениями NoData, мозаичное изображение также будет содержать значения NoData (и приложение не будет выполнять поиск перекрывающихся растров, содержащих различные значения пикселов). Если Нет, то приложение будет пытаться найти значения, чтобы заполнить NoData, используя перекрывающиеся растры.
- Всегда вырезать набор данных мозаики по его границе – используется для ограничения экстента изображения по геометрии границы или по экстенту границы. Если выбрано Да это ограничивает экстент изображения по геометрии границы. Если выбрано Нет, экстент изображения обрезается по экстенту границы.
- Применить коррекцию цвета (Apply Color Correction): если же используется метод коррекции цвета для набора данных мозаики, вы можете применить его при использовании метода мозаики Ближайший к точке просмотра (Closest to Viewpoint).
- Минимальное влияние пикселей – позволяет выбрать допуск минимального влияния пикселей. Определяет минимальное число пикселей в области интереса, необходимых для того, чтобы элемент набора данных мозаики рассматривался как часть этой области. Значение по умолчанию – 1 пиксель. Большие значения могут понизить вероятность того, что пересекающийся элемент является частью области интереса; это может привести к появлению пустых областей в наборе данных мозаики. Это свойство действует только тогда, когда для параметра Всегда вырезать растр по контуру задано значение Да, а для Контуры могут содержать NoData выбрано Нет. Это свойство полезно, только если в наборе данных мозаики встречаются перекрывающиеся растры.
Свойства каталога
- Уровень метаданных растра (Raster Metadata Level): определяет, сколько метаданных будут переданы с сервера клиенту. Это может повлиять на время передачи, если переносится много метаданных; таким образом, вы можете ограничить их. Опции:
- Full – Основная информация о наборе растровых данных и детали последовательности функции будут перенесены. Это значение используется по умолчанию.
- Basic – Уровень информации набора растровых данных будет перенесен, например, информация о столбцах и строках, размере ячейки и пространственной привязке.
- None – Никаких метаданных передано не будет.
- Максимальное число записей, возвращаемых по запросу (Maximum Number Of Records Returned Per Request): ограничивает запрашиваемое количество запрашиваемых записей, которые будут выдаваться сервером при просмотре набора данных мозаики в качестве опубликованного сервиса изображений.
- Допустимые поля (Allowed Fields): определяет, какие поля таблицы атрибутов будут видимыми клиенту при обслуживании набора данных мозаики.
Время (Time): если набор данных мозаики содержит поля атрибутов, определяющие время, вы можете создать набор данных мозаики, который будет автоматически зависеть от времени. Это означает, что свойства времени в слое будут определяться по умолчанию. Вы можете определить поле для начального и конечного времени и формат времени. Рекомендуется хранить значения времени в поле даты; однако, также поддерживаются строковые и числовые поля.
- Преобразование географической системы координат (Geographic Coordinate System Transformation): если система пространственной привязки набора данных мозаики основана на ином сфероиде, чем система пространственной привязки исходных растровых данных, то вам может понадобиться задать определенное географическое преобразование. Этот параметр дает вам доступ к диалоговому окну, чтобы помочь в выборе географического преобразования.
Свойства загрузки
- Максимальное число загружаемых элементов за запрос (Maximum number of items downloadable per request): ограничивает число растров, которые может загрузить клиент из сервиса изображений. Вы можете установить это значение на 0, если не хотите, чтобы клиент загружал растры из набора растров мозаики. Дополнительно, это значение может влиять на загрузку. Вы можете настроить это число в зависимости от того, как клиенты будут использовать их сервисы изображений.Примечание:
Исходные файлы, которые хранятся в формате растра Grid, не могут быть загружены.
- Максимальный объем загрузки при запросе – количество мегабайт, которое может быть загружено за один раз.